Some of these forum discussions talk about the process for editing the code to add a new field. How you do that will depend heavily on what version of OJS you’re running.
The reason we’re hesitant to add fields like this is because it’s only relevant to a very small part of our global community, and there is nowhere in OJS for that data to be used – it would only be visible to the Editor. We’re more likely to add metadata fields that play a role in downstream consumers of metadata like JATS, CrossRef, etc.
